Understanding payment Bonds: What They Are and Exactly how They Work



When you study the world of building and construction tasks, you'll usually come across payment bonds. These financial devices work as guarantees that professionals will pay their subcontractors and vendors for labor and products.

Essentially, a repayment bond protects these events if the professional defaults on repayments. It's a three-party arrangement entailing the job owner, the professional, and the surety business that issues the bond.



You'll discover payment bonds specifically common in public field tasks, where they're usually mandated by regulation. If the service provider stops working to pay, the surety company steps in to cover the prices, making sure that all events get their due compensation.

Comprehending payment bonds is critical for navigating the complexities of building funding and securing your financial investments.
